Output 2c40fe804a20374ab6613223612fc1fa9251a70be6959088ec2550fd2cc39c30:1

value
17546845
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51f413c624951a69531aef82177f7ca703534ebe OP_EQUALVERIFY OP_CHECKSIG
address
LShHPY1EtfL69hDBgf4DWBdirt1DKEtTLD
transaction
2c40fe804a20374ab6613223612fc1fa9251a70be6959088ec2550fd2cc39c30
spent
true